WebJun 15, 2006 · The terms Rp (1.0) and Rp(0.2) refer to proof (tensile yield) stress values at 1% and 0.2% permanent deformation, respectively. These values are determined from … Web1. The deformation amount is 0.2% to count as yielded for steel. Hard steels and non-ferrous metals do not have defined yield limit, therefore a stress, corresponding to a definite …

WebMar 17, 2024 · Since yield points are difficult to determine exactly, a practical engineering measure for comparing conductors is 0.2% proof stress which is the stress required to produce a permanent 0.2% plastic lengthening of the conductor. WebApr 13, 2024 · Sorted by: 1. if the material is mild steel then the easiest way to find the yield stress is to plot the stress strain and find the first knee in the curve. if the material does not have a clear yield point, what you do, is you start from 0.2% strain and draw a straight line parallel to the Elastic part of the line (see below).

WebType 316L stainless steel density is 0.289 lb/in3 (8.0 g/cm3); melting point is 1375-1400 °C (2500-2550 °F); 0.2% yield strength is minimum 25 ksi (170 MPa) in annealed and hot finished condition, minimum 45 ksi (310 MPa) in annealed and cold finished condition; Minimum tensile strength is 70 ksi (485 MPa) in annealed and hot finished condition,...
